Stampeder Inn is an excellent choice for travellers visiting Ponoka, offering a charming environment alongside many helpful amenities designed to enhance your stay.
The rooms offer a refrigerator, air conditioning, and a kitchenette, and getting online is possible, as free wifi is available, allowing you to rest and refresh with ease.
In addition, as a valued Stampeder Inn guest, you can enjoy free breakfast that is available on-site. Guests arriving by vehicle have access to free parking.
Travellers looking for Italian restaurants can head to Pizza D'oro Pizza & Pasta.

This little Inn just off the highway is a hidden gem. I found it by chance in November when winter came suddenly and the roads were extremely slippery and dangerous.
I called a few places while sitting still on the icy highway and finally found an available room here. The gentleman on the phone was very kind and patient, and when I got there a couple of hours later there was a full lobby with many stranded travellers. The husband and wife managers were super professional and worked really hard to accommodate everyone, and were just great people. The whole place is clean and comforting, and they are ale great pride in running a top-notch place. They even have fresh breakfast with all you need right there with morning coffee and tea and juices etc.
The room was awesome and clean, and newly renovated. Everyone there was so grateful to have such a great place to be safe for the night.
And the steak house next door is perfect for real home-cooked food as well!
I’ll definitely keep it in mind for another time, and highly recommend it:)
